Analyst Compensation salary in France

Average Yearly Salary of Analyst Compensation in France is approximately 57,542 EUR (57,486 USD). Data is for 2025 and indicates a pre-tax value. The salary itself depends on multiple factors such as seniority, job performance, certifications, experience or any other bonuses. What does Analyst Compensation do?

occupation personasAn analyst compensation is responsible for evaluating and managing employee compensation packages within an organization. They analyze salary data, market trends, and company policies to determine fair and competitive compensation structures. This involves conducting salary surveys, benchmarking against industry standards, and making recommendations to ensure that employees are appropriately rewarded for their skills and contributions. Analysts compensation also play a crucial role in designing and implementing incentive programs, such as bonuses and stock options, to motivate and retain top talent. They collaborate with HR teams, finance departments, and senior management to develop and administer compensation policies and procedures. Attention to detail, strong analytical skills, and knowledge of labor laws and regulations are essential in this role.

Skills: Compensation analysis, Salary benchmarking, Incentive programs, Employee rewards, Compensation policies, Labor laws.
